How they compare
Brunei Darussalam currently reports 2,313 t against 2,302 t in Morocco, a difference of 11 t.
The two have swapped places 3 times across 37 shared years of data; in 1980 it was Morocco ahead.
Brunei Darussalam ranks 148th and Morocco ranks 149th of 215 countries.
Morocco has averaged higher in every one of the 5 decades both report.
Head to head by decade
| Decade | Brunei Darussalam | Morocco | Difference | Ahead |
|---|---|---|---|---|
| 1980s | 141.5 t | 300 t | 158.5 t | Morocco |
| 1990s | 710.7 t | 1,638 t | 927.1 t | Morocco |
| 2000s | 83.9 t | 12,537 t | 12,453 t | Morocco |
| 2010s | 45.1 t | 9,373 t | 9,328 t | Morocco |
| 2020s | 594.6 t | 3,833 t | 3,239 t | Morocco |
Averages of every year both report within each decade.

About this data
The Fertilizers by Nutrient dataset contains information on the totals in nutrients for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ers. The data are provided for the three primary plant nutrients: nitrogen (N), phosphorus (expressed as P2O5) and potassium (expressed as K2O). Both straight and compound fertilizers are included.
